Title: Island-wide energy storage planning strategy toward zero-emission target and power system security

Abstract: This final year project presents a study of energy storage system modelling and planning followed by concluding on the most suitable and cost-effective strategy in combining short and long-term energy storage based on the Energy 2050 Committee Report to ensure grid reliability. This report is intended to be used by the government for policy planning and private enterprise for business decisions. The conclusion is presented through storage sizing calculation, power grid modelling and asset design strategy.
